“…When using software emulated IOV methods, the network interfaces are virtual so their internal state is stored into the memory and gets copied as well, thus, the downtime is in the order of a few milliseconds [60]. In the case of direct device assignment and SR-IOV VFs, the internal state of the network interface cannot be copied because it is stored into the hardware that is not able to move [31,120]. The SR-IOV Virtual Function (VF) assigned to the VM will first need to be detached, the live migration will run, and a new VF will be attached at the destination.…”
